UNPKG

748 BJavaScriptView Raw
1"use strict";
2
3/**
4 * Map of all block types. Blocks can contain inlines or blocks.
5 * @type {Map}
6 */
7
8module.exports = {
9 DOCUMENT: "document",
10 TEXT: "unstyled",
11 // Classic blocks
12 CODE: "code_block",
13 CODE_LINE: "code_line",
14 BLOCKQUOTE: "blockquote",
15 PARAGRAPH: "paragraph",
16 FOOTNOTE: "footnote",
17 HTML: "html_block",
18 HR: "hr",
19 // Headings
20 HEADING_1: "header_one",
21 HEADING_2: "header_two",
22 HEADING_3: "header_three",
23 HEADING_4: "header_four",
24 HEADING_5: "header_five",
25 HEADING_6: "header_six",
26 // Table
27 TABLE: "table",
28 TABLE_ROW: "table_row",
29 TABLE_CELL: "table_cell",
30 // Lists
31 OL_LIST: "ordered_list",
32 UL_LIST: "unordered_list",
33 LIST_ITEM: "list_item",
34
35 // Default block
36 DEFAULT: "paragraph"
37};
\No newline at end of file